Personal Chef Services
For our clients with special dietary requirements, we understand that making the transition to preparing foods that are free of allergens will present a challenge. Suddenly, many of your favorite foods are unfriendly, and it may be difficult to find comfort and sustenance. We are here to assist your transition to a diet that is health-supporting for you and your new dietary restrictions.
Together, we will customize a Master Menu full of suitable options that suit your new dietary guidelines, then prepare them fresh in our clients’ homes on a weekly, biweekly, monthly or as-needed basis. High quality, fresh ingredients possible are procured from local natural foods markets, and used to create a menu that suits your specific dietary needs, including vegan, vegetarian, gluten-free, and multiple allergy diets. This will be your opportunity to try new recipes and become accustomed to the tastes of foods made with body & belly friendly substitutes for your family favorites.
Our chef will come to your home to prepare the menu items selected, then package, label and store the food in your fridge or freezer. Come home to a clean kitchen, enjoy the delicious aroma of home-cooking and find your refrigerator and freezer stocked with delicious, nutritious meals. Mealtime will be a culinary adventure again!

Private Cooking Lessons
We offer one-on-one, personalized instruction of recipes that match your specific dietary needs. Each class includes planning & shopping and preparing a balanced, 3-4-course whole foods meal, customized for your specific dietary limitations.
